A Quitclaim Deed Form is a legal document used to transfer ownership of real estate from one party to another without any guarantees about the property title. This form is commonly used in situations like transferring property between family members or clearing up title issues. By using a Quitclaim Deed Form, the grantor relinquishes any claim to the property, making it a straightforward option for quick transfers.
